America in 2021 is the largest slave-owning nation in the world. The 13th Amendment states that “Neither slavery nor involuntary servitude, except as a punishment for crime whereof the party shall have been duly convicted, shall exist within the United States.” By definition, slavery is the punishment for a convicted felon. The United States has only 9% of the world’s population but 25% of the world’s prison population. This disproportion is simply another example of the disenfranchisement that this country was built upon, and until we have competent advocates within the criminal justice system, marginalized citizens will continue to be victims. Change must be sudden, purposeful, and calculated to address the 400 years of discrimination until we are all free.
